The All Progressives Congress governorship candidate in the ongoing 2025 Anambra State election, Prince Ukachukwu, has won his polling unit.
The result was announced by the Presiding Officer, IfeanyiChukwu Chikams Peace at about 4:01pm on Saturday.
Ukachukwu cast his vote at Polling Unit 12, Ward 2, Umudiala village, in Osumenyi, Nnewi South Local Government Area.

He scored 108 votes in Booth 1, while the All Progressives Grand Alliance (APGA) candidate received four votes.
In Booth 2, APC secured 126 votes, compared with six votes for APGA.

VerseNews reports that shortly after voting, Ukachukwu alleged widespread vote buying across the state, describing it as a “menace” that could cripple the country’s electoral process if left unchecked.
He claimed that some party agents had been attacked in areas such as Utuh in Nnewi South and called on security agencies to enforce the law and prevent electoral fraud.
Despite the allegations, Ukachukwu expressed confidence that his party would emerge victorious, emphasising that voting was a civic duty and proof of his qualification to both vote and be voted for.

He also commended the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) for the timely arrival of election materials and officials, which he said helped streamline the process.
VerseNews reports that vote counting has begun in Anambra as 16 candidates vie to unseat APGA’s Chukwuma Soludo.
